    HSL - New membership option

    Did everyone get a leaflet at the match yesterday?
    There is now a new membership option of £7.73 per month to join HSL which will hopefully encourage a few more members to back Alan Stubbs in the January transfer window.
    It only takes 2 minutes to sign up, I promise.
